#!/usr/bin/env python3
from functools import partial
from time import time
from jax import grad, jit, lax
from jax import numpy as jnp
from jax import random as jrand
from jax.example_libraries import optimizers
from args import args
from expect import expect
from net import get_net, prev_index_2d
from utils import (clear_log, get_last_ckpt_step, init_out_dir, load_ckpt,
my_log, print_args, save_ckpt)
args.log_filename = args.full_out_dir + 'train.log'
# spins: (batch, L, L, 1), values in {-1, 1}
def energy_fun(spins):
if args.lattice == 'ising':
# 2D classical Ising model, square lattice, periodic boundary
env = jnp.roll(spins, 1, axis=1) + jnp.roll(spins, 1, axis=2)
energy = (spins * env).sum(axis=(1, 2, 3))
return energy
elif args.lattice == 'fpm':
# Frustrated plaquette model
sx = jnp.roll(spins, 1, axis=1)
sy = jnp.roll(spins, 1, axis=2)
sxy = jnp.roll(spins, 1, axis=(1, 2))
sx2 = jnp.roll(spins, 2, axis=1)
sy2 = jnp.roll(spins, 2, axis=2)
env = -sx - sy - sx2 - sy2 + 2 * sx * sy * sxy
energy = (spins * env).sum(axis=(1, 2, 3))
return energy
else:
raise ValueError(f'Unknown lattice: {args.lattice}')
# We never take the gradient through the sampling procedure
def get_sample_fun(net_apply, cache_init):
use_fast = (cache_init is not None)
indices = [(i, j) for i in range(args.L) for j in range(args.L)]
indices = jnp.asarray(indices)
@partial(jit, static_argnums=0)
def sample_fun(batch_size, params, rng_init):
def scan_fun(carry, _args):
spins, cache = carry
(i, j), rng = _args
if use_fast:
i_in, j_in = prev_index_2d(i, j, args.L)
spins_slice = spins[:, i_in, j_in, :]
spins_slice = jnp.expand_dims(spins_slice, axis=(1, 2))
s_hat, cache = net_apply(params, spins_slice, cache, (i, j))
s_hat = s_hat.squeeze(axis=(1, 2))
else:
s_hat = net_apply(params, spins)
s_hat = s_hat[:, i, j, :]
# s_hat are parameters of Bernoulli distributions
spins_new = jrand.bernoulli(rng, s_hat).astype(jnp.float32) * 2 - 1
spins = spins.at[:, i, j, :].set(spins_new)
return (spins, cache), None
rngs = jrand.split(rng_init, args.L**2)
spins_init = jnp.zeros((batch_size, args.L, args.L, 1))
(spins, _), _ = lax.scan(scan_fun, (spins_init, cache_init),
(indices, rngs))
return spins
return sample_fun
def get_log_q_fun(net_apply):
def log_q_fun(params, spins):
mask = (spins + 1) / 2
s_hat = net_apply(params, spins)
log_q = jnp.log(mask * s_hat + (1 - mask) * (1 - s_hat) + args.eps)
log_q = log_q.sum(axis=(1, 2, 3))
return log_q
return log_q_fun
def main():
start_time = time()
init_out_dir()
last_step = get_last_ckpt_step()
if last_step >= 0:
my_log(f'\nCheckpoint found: {last_step}\n')
else:
clear_log()
print_args()
net_init, net_apply, net_init_cache, net_apply_fast = get_net()
rng, rng_net = jrand.split(jrand.PRNGKey(args.seed))
in_shape = (args.batch_size, args.L, args.L, 1)
out_shape, params_init = net_init(rng_net, in_shape)
_, cache_init = net_init_cache(params_init, jnp.zeros(in_shape), (-1, -1))
# sample_fun = get_sample_fun(net_apply, None)
sample_fun = get_sample_fun(net_apply_fast, cache_init)
log_q_fun = get_log_q_fun(net_apply)
need_beta_anneal = args.beta_anneal_step > 0
opt_init, opt_update, get_params = optimizers.adam(args.lr)
@jit
def update(step, opt_state, rng):
params = get_params(opt_state)
rng, rng_sample = jrand.split(rng)
spins = sample_fun(args.batch_size, params, rng_sample)
log_q = log_q_fun(params, spins) / args.L**2
energy = energy_fun(spins) / args.L**2
def neg_log_Z_fun(params, spins):
log_q = log_q_fun(params, spins) / args.L**2
energy = energy_fun(spins) / args.L**2
beta = args.beta
if need_beta_anneal:
beta *= jnp.minimum(step / args.beta_anneal_step, 1)
neg_log_Z = log_q + beta * energy
return neg_log_Z
loss_fun = partial(expect,
log_q_fun,
neg_log_Z_fun,
mean_grad_expected_is_zero=True)
grads = grad(loss_fun)(params, spins, spins)
opt_state = opt_update(step, grads, opt_state)
return spins, log_q, energy, opt_state, rng
if last_step >= 0:
params_init = load_ckpt(last_step)
opt_state = opt_init(params_init)
my_log('Training...')
for step in range(last_step + 1, args.max_step + 1):
spins, log_q, energy, opt_state, rng = update(step, opt_state, rng)
if args.print_step and step % args.print_step == 0:
# Use the final beta, not the annealed beta
free_energy = log_q / args.beta + energy
my_log(', '.join([
f'step = {step}',
f'F = {free_energy.mean():.8g}',
f'F_std = {free_energy.std():.8g}',
f'S = {-log_q.mean():.8g}',
f'E = {energy.mean():.8g}',
f'time = {time() - start_time:.3f}',
]))
if args.save_step and step % args.save_step == 0:
params = get_params(opt_state)
save_ckpt(params, step)
if __name__ == '__main__':
main()
